【问题标题】:Gridlayout - how to add nothing to it?Gridlayout - 如何添加任何内容?
【发布时间】:2013-11-09 02:00:09
【问题描述】:

所以我有一个网格布局,当我在另一个类中循环时,我想在那里添加一个按钮,或者不添加一个按钮。如果我不希望它在那里,我将如何通过并添加任何内容?

它是 Nqueens,所以我必须制作一个特定于用户想要的尺寸的板,然后我必须通过将按钮放在屏幕上来展示它是如何实现的

【问题讨论】:

    标签: java function layout methods


    【解决方案1】:

    您只需要将add 语句设为有条件的:

    gbc.gridwidth = blah;
    ...
    if (condition)
        container.add(component);
    

    【讨论】:

    • 对,但那不会在正确的位置吗?因为那只会将它们添加到彼此旁边
    猜你喜欢
    • 1970-01-01
    • 2011-09-21
    • 1970-01-01
    • 2010-12-26
    • 1970-01-01
    • 1970-01-01
    • 2014-04-19
    • 1970-01-01
    相关资源
    最近更新 更多